never ever put gorilla tape in your rims

I will keep repeating this coz it’s the damn truth:
the woven gorilla tape is FUCKING USELESS AND SHIT for tubeless tape. Yes it will hold for maybe a month or so but then the raw woven edge will start sucking up fluid sealant until it’s saturated and you will have slow leaks all round your rim through every spoke hole.

Yes their clear tape will work since it’s not woven but that’s just stupid expensive when you can buy 3M strapping tape in big rolls on ebay…
3M 8898 & 8896 is the blue stuff that’s often re-branded.
